Disneyland Abu Dhabi is officially happening. The Walt Disney Company and Miral have confirmed plans to develop a landmark Disney theme park resort on Yas Island, Abu Dhabi, marking Disney’s first theme park in the Middle East and its seventh globally. Set along a stunning waterfront north of Yas Island, the project will introduce a new era of entertainment to the UAE, combining Disney’s iconic storytelling with cutting-edge design, advanced technology, and a distinctly Emirati identity. The resort is expected to open between 2030 and 2032, with phased development already underway.

Disney and Miral Partner on Abu Dhabi Theme Park
The Walt Disney Company has officially confirmed a partnership with Miral to develop a world-class Disney theme park resort in Abu Dhabi. This new destination will feature a flagship Disney theme park anchored by a breathtaking, modern Disney castle. To accommodate visitors, the resort will offer a variety of themed hotels and immersive dining, retail, and entertainment experiences.
Disney CEO Bob Iger described the vision for the park as being “authentically Disney, yet distinctly Emirati.” This design philosophy ensures that the destination maintains Disney’s global magic while honoring the United Arab Emirates’ unique culture, architecture, and storytelling traditions.
Disneyland on Yas Island
Disneyland Abu Dhabi will be developed north of Yas Island, along a prime waterfront zone designed to support large-scale tourism and leisure developments. Yas Island was selected for this landmark project due to its established reputation as a premier destination for large-scale entertainment and lifestyle experiences. The island already serves as a global hub, hosting world-renowned attractions such as Ferrari World, Warner Bros. World, and SeaWorld Abu Dhabi. As an integrated, master-planned community, it seamlessly blends residential living, luxury hospitality, and high-end retail with world-class leisure facilities.

Construction Timeline
The Disneyland Abu Dhabi project is expected to span approximately 125 hectares (1.25 million square meters), making it one of Disney’s largest developments worldwide. Once completed, the resort will offer multiple themed lands, immersive attractions, themed hotels, and entertainment districts.
Estimated development timeline:
2024–2025: Site preparation, utilities, and land development
2026–2028: Vertical construction, themed zones, ride installation
2029–2030: Final theming, testing, and soft opening
2030–2032: Full launch and phased expansions
